3. Plan the Right Machine Mix for Your Arcade Center
The machine mix is the foundation of an arcade project. A good supplier should recommend machines based on customer groups, venue size, and expected revenue model.
Arcade Machine Mix Guide
| Zone | Recommended Machines | Business Purpose |
| Entrance Zone | Claw machines, prize machines | Attract walk-in customers |
| Kids Zone | Kiddie rides, mini arcade machines | Serve younger children |
| Family Zone | Redemption games, simple interactive games | Encourage shared play |
| Teen Zone | Racing, shooting, basketball games | Increase competition and replay |
| Prize Zone | Ticket machines, redemption games, prize counter | Build reward motivation |
| Premium Zone | VR machines, simulator games | Add high-value experience |
A shopping mall arcade may need bright claw machines and compact games near high-traffic areas. A family entertainment center may need a balanced mix of kiddie rides, redemption games, sports machines, racing machines, and prize zones. A larger amusement center may need multiple themed zones for different age groups.
4. Layout Planning Helps Increase Revenue
Machine placement directly affects customer movement and play behavior. Even good machines may perform poorly if they are placed in low-visibility areas.
A practical arcade layout should consider:
- Entrance visibility
- Main walking path
- Machine spacing
- Age group zoning
- Prize counter position
- Parent rest area
- Staff supervision
- Safety distance
- Payment system access
- Future expansion space
For example, claw machines are often effective near entrances because they are easy to understand and visually attractive. Redemption machines work well near the prize counter because players can clearly see the reward system. Racing and basketball games are better placed together to create a competitive atmosphere.

5. OEM/ODM Customization for Turnkey Arcade Projects
Many arcade projects need customized machines to match the venue brand, local market, or interior theme.
Common customization options include:
- Logo customization
- Cabinet color matching
- Theme artwork
- Language settings
- Voltage and plug adjustment
- Coin, token, card, or cashless payment system
- Game difficulty setting
- Prize display design
- Packaging label
- Full venue visual matching
Customization is especially important for shopping mall arcades, branded FECs, arcade chains, and distributors. A consistent machine style can make the venue look more professional and easier to promote.
Before production, buyers should confirm artwork files, logo placement, color samples, payment system requirements, voltage, plug type, quantity, and delivery schedule.
6. Quality Control Before Shipment

Arcade machines are commercial equipment. They may be used every day by children, teenagers, adults, and families. Reliable quality control helps reduce downtime and protects long-term revenue.
Before choosing an arcade turnkey project supplier, buyers should ask:
- Are machines tested before shipment?
- Can testing photos or videos be provided?
- Are payment systems checked?
- Are screens, lights, sound, buttons, and controls tested?
- Are ticket and redemption systems inspected?
- Are customized logos and cabinet designs checked?
- Are spare parts available?
- What is the warranty policy?
Arcade Project QC Checklist
| QC Area | What to Confirm |
| Gameplay Function | Machines run smoothly |
| Payment System | Coin, card, or cashless systems work |
| Controls | Buttons, joysticks, wheels, and guns respond well |
| Ticket System | Redemption output is accurate |
| Cabinet Quality | Strong enough for commercial use |
| Lighting & Screen | Stable visual performance |
| Custom Appearance | Logo, artwork, and colors are correct |
| Packaging | Safe for international shipping |
A reliable turnkey supplier should check both machine function and customized details before delivery.
7. Export Packaging, Shipping, and Installation Support
For overseas arcade projects, export service is very important. Arcade machines may include screens, glass, acrylic panels, motors, sensors, LED lights, control boards, and payment systems. Poor packaging may cause damage and delay the opening schedule.
Before ordering, buyers should ask:
- What packaging method do you use?
- Do you use foam, bubble wrap, wooden frames, or wooden crates?
- Are accessories packed separately?
- Is a packing list included?
- Can you provide loading photos?
- Can you arrange sea freight?
- Can you work with my freight forwarder?
- Do you provide installation manuals or videos?
- Can spare parts be shipped together?
Good packaging, clear documents, and installation guidance can make the project smoother after arrival.
